The History of the Gotham Font: From Creation to Fame
Gotham font came to life in 2000. Hoefler & Frere-Jones crafted it perfectly. They took inspiration from mid-century architectural signage across New York City. The designers intentionally created a typeface that felt clean and professional yet approachable.
After its release, it became a hit immediately. Designers loved how unique and clear it looked. Over time, Gotham basically gained global recognition. Barack Obama’s 2008 presidential campaign used the font prominently. This was a turning point in its popularity.

What is the origin story of the Gotham Font?
The Gotham font began in 2000. Hoefler & Frere-Jones designed it inspired by New York typography history. Bar signs and architectural text inspired the typeface. It was modernized carefully to fit branding needs.

Are there free alternatives to Gotham Font for designers?
Gotham requires licensing fees sometimes. Alternatives like Montserrat or Raleway replicate Gotham qualities well. They are freely downloadable. Murmurations showcase similar aesthetic if cost limits occur.
